タイムスタンプは、コンピュータが日付と時刻を保存する方法であり、通常は特定の日付から経過した秒数を表します。 PHP では、date() 関数を使用して、タイムスタンプを特定の形式の日付と時刻に変換できます。この記事では、タイムスタンプを月に変換する方法を説明します。
タイムスタンプの取得
PHP では、time() 関数を使用して現在の時刻のタイムスタンプを取得できます。 time() 関数によって返されるタイムスタンプは、1970 年 1 月 1 日の 00:00:00 UTC (協定世界時) から経過した秒数を表す整数です。
以下は、time() 関数を使用してタイムスタンプを取得するコード例です。
$timestamp = time(); echo $timestamp;
上記のコードは、以下に示すように、現在時刻のタイムスタンプを出力します。
1623832048時刻を変更するスタンプを月に変換するPHP では、date() 関数を使用して、タイムスタンプを特定の形式の日付と時刻に変換できます。月に変換する場合は、完全な月名を表す「F」パラメータを使用する必要があります。以下はタイムスタンプを月に変換するコード例です:
$timestamp = time(); $month = date("F", $timestamp); echo $month;上記のコードは、以下に示すように現在の月の完全な名前を出力します:
Juneタイムスタンプを数値に変換することもできます。月の形式を指定するには、「m」パラメータを使用します。以下は、タイムスタンプを数値形式の月に変換するコード例です:
$timestamp = time(); $month = date("m", $timestamp); echo $month;上記のコードは、現在の月の数値形式を次のように出力します:
06Custom timestamp
特定の日付をタイムスタンプに変換したい場合は、strtotime() 関数を使用できます。 strtotime() 関数は、文字列形式の日時をタイムスタンプに変換できます。文字列には、「YYYY-MM-DD」、「MM/DD/YYYY」、「YYYY-MM-DD HH:MM:SS」など、さまざまな形式を使用できます。 以下は、文字列の日付と時刻をタイムスタンプに変換するコード例です:
$date = "2022-02-22"; $timestamp = strtotime($date); echo $timestamp;上記のコードは、以下に示すように、指定された日付のタイムスタンプを出力します:
1645478400上記で紹介した方法を使用して、タイムスタンプを月に変換できます。 結論以上がPHPのタイムスタンプを月に変換する方法です。 date() 関数を使用してタイムスタンプを特定の形式の日付と時刻に変換し、「F」パラメータで月を完全な名前に変換し、「m」パラメータで月を数値形式に変換できます。 。 strtotime() 関数を使用して文字列日時をタイムスタンプに変換することもできます。
以上がPHP タイムスタンプを月に変換する方法について話しましょうの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。